Eviction Order for Major Repairs - Tehranipanah v Powell

LTB Order for Renovation and Compensation

🕑 Case timeline

Application Date: Date not provided

Hearing Date: February 6, 2023

Order Issued: April 5, 2023

Termination Date: April 16, 2023

Eviction Deadline: April 16, 2023

ℹ️ Case overview

Case Number: LTB-L-017452-22
Address: 55 HERSEY CRES, Barrie ON L4N 8R2
Form Used: N13
Served By: LTB
Amount Awarded: $2,000.00
Decision In Favor: Landlord
Application Type: Eviction for major repairs or renovations
RTA Sections: Section 69, Subsection 50(1)(c), Subsection 73(1)(a), Subsection 83(1), Subsection 83(2)

👥 Parties involved

Landlord: Mahyar Tehranipanah, Masoumeh Roosta
Landlord Rep: Ali Golabir
Tenant: Tyrone Powell
Tenant Rep: Self Represented
Adjudicator: Greg Witt
Keywords: eviction, major repairs, renovations, compensation, building permit

⚖️ Decision summary

Tenancy terminated; Tenant must vacate by April 16, 2023.
Landlords provided necessary compensation for displacement.

⚠️ Dispute summary

Landlords intend to perform extensive renovations requiring building permit.
Tenant did not attend the hearing.

📑 Findings & determinations

Landlords have a good faith intention to renovate.
Tenant was properly served and compensated.

💡 Summary points

Landlords require vacant possession for extensive renovations.
Tenant compensated with one month's rent for relocation.
Eviction order issued with a compliance deadline.
